Create your account
- 1Go to the sign-up page and register with your email and a password.
- 2Confirm your email through the link we send you — this activates your account.
- 3Sign in. If you ever forget your password, use Forgot password on the login page to receive a reset link.
New accounts start on the Free plan, which includes one workspace and every module. You only upgrade when you need higher limits.
Create a workspace
A workspace is the container for everything you build — its own contacts, forms, invoices, calendar and team. Most businesses need only one; agencies sometimes run several.
- 1From your dashboard, create a workspace and give it a name.
- 2You become the workspace owner automatically — the one role with full access to everything.
- 3Open the workspace to reach its home dashboard and the left-nav sidebar.
Understand the modules
Flowpera is organised into modules. Six of them are access-gated so you can hand teammates exactly what they need:

Tasks and Discussions aren't module-gated — they use assignment and channel membership instead — and Support tickets are account-wide, available to anyone signed in.
Invite your team
- 1Open the Team area and send an in-app invitation by email address — no email actually leaves the platform.
- 2The invitee sees the invitation on their own dashboard and accepts or declines it there.
- 3Assign them a role (manager or staff) and grant the specific modules they should reach.
Grant modules narrowly at first. Staff see nothing in a module until you unlock it, so a new hire never stumbles onto your invoices on day one.
